Account recovery for the Skreel queue-depth autoscaler follows the standard break-glass flow. If the scaler's service account is locked out, halt scale decisions first (they fail open to current replica count). Then re-enroll via the Vantrel console using the team recovery passphrase. For reference, the current passphrase is below.

vault phrase of tajop-haduf = holath-brivan-wenax

Quarterly Planning Note — Sales Leads, Marovent Ltd

The Quillshore product line will be retired at the end of Q2. No new contracts from March; renewals honoured through year-end. Migration incentives to the Ashvern platform are available for accounts over 200 seats. Commission on Quillshore deals continues unchanged until retirement. Talk tracks and objection handling arrive next week. The strategic rationale is covered in the confidential note below.

internal memo for kawip-hadug: Headcount on the Wenwyn team goes from 7 to 140 by the end of January. Gross margin on Wenwyn came in at 20 percent against a plan of 15 percent.

**CI note: timezone weirdness in report exports**

Heads up, support folks — if a customer says their Ledgerpine export shows times shifted by a few hours, it's probably the CI image. The export workers got rebuilt last week and the base image defaults to UTC, while older workers used the account's locale. Fix is rolling out; meanwhile tell customers the data itself is fine, just the display offset. Affected exports carry the build token shown below.

build token for bajof-tahop: htk4_a981

Q: Can our people use the shared lab on Level 3 with the Quillmere team? A: Yep — it's a joint space now, so both teams badge in through the same door by the kitchenette. Visitors still need an escort, and reception should log anyone borrowing equipment. If someone's badge hasn't been provisioned yet, don't send them upstairs empty-handed; just give them the temporary door code below.

door code, yagap-bahof: bdg-O-05

# Heads up for the release manager: this client talks to Lintkeeper,
# our static-analysis gateway. The baseline file (lint_baseline.json)
# pins all the legacy findings we've agreed to ignore, so don't
# regenerate it unless you actually mean to wipe the slate — the
# diff will be enormous and reviewers will hate you. The client
# uploads new findings against that baseline on every release cut.
# Auth is a plain header; the key for the Lintkeeper service is below.

API key for yahig-tadup: kto7_ubizbYm